To provide a centrifugal dewatering washing machine capable of washing the washing independently of positioning thereof inside an inner tub and capable of reducing the quantity of detergent and the washing time while preventing the unevenness of washing.
An outer tub 3 is flexibly supported inside a case 2 of the centrifugal dewatering washing machine and the inner tub 6 provided with multiple side surface water passing holes 5 on a side surface thereof is supported inside the outer tub 3 freely to be rotated. When a motor 7 is rotated and the inner tub 6 and a pulsator 11 are rotated, the washing water 4 is allowed to flow from the side surface water passing holes 5 into the outer tub 3 through the washing 10 to be washed by the centrifugal force, and rotating speed of the washing water flowing into the outer vessel 3 is reduced by the frictional work between the inner tub surface at an outer tub 6 side. The washing water is circulated to a bottom part 18 inside the outer tub 3 by a pressure difference between inside of the outer tub 3 and inside of the inner tub 6, and circulated into the inner tub 3 through water passing holes 13 formed on a bottom surface of the inner tub 6 and the water passing holes 12 provided in the pulsator 11 so as to wash washing 10.
